Can a fluid storage tank explode

Can a fluid storage tank explode

Lightning strikes and other triggers which may ignite the vapors inside a tank may cause the tank to explode and the resulting fire and/or the rocking fragments of the shattered tank may cause adjacent tanks to fail (Taveau, 2011).

What happens if a tank explodes?

If a tank undergoes explosion, its rocketing fragments can damage even those tanks which are lying outside the range of the heat load impact. The meteorological conditions, especially wind speed and direction, prevailing at the time of an accident can influence the harm that accident may cause.

What is overfilling of flammable liquid in storage tank?

Overfilling of flammable liquid is one of the common operational error in storage tank. There are some cases of overfilling of flammable liquid like in benzene tank, phenol tank, oil product tank, crude oil tank and gasoline tank which had resulted in big accidents.
